Verdict
Stephen Ryan is striking while the iron is red hot with Rolling Rocket, who picked up a 6lb penalty for his victory at Punchestown on New Year's Eve. He didn't win with as much authority as on this track earlier but looked to have a bit in hand and will make a bold bid to complete a hat-trick. However, BOHER CALL, who was eight lengths behind in that earlier race over the track and trip, is 12lb better off and though beaten over a longer trip subsequently must have a major chance of reversing the form. The Conker Club has put early jumping problems behind her and been consistent over fences but she's been back over hurdles for her recent races and has failed to take advantage of a lower mark. Is Herself About was competing at a much higher level than this when last seen in the spring and isn't out of this despite a big weight.
